Job Title: Chartered Accountant (CA) - Pharmaceutical / Trading Industry

Location: [Karol Bagh, New Delhi]

Position Type: [Full-Time]

Job Summary:
We are looking for a highly skilled and detail-oriented Chartered Accountant (CA) with a strong background in the pharmaceutical or trading industry. The ideal candidate will be responsible for managing the financial functions of the company, ensuring compliance with tax laws, and contributing to the overall financial strategy. This position requires extensive knowledge of industry-specific accounting regulations, financial reporting, cost analysis, and strategic financial planning.

Key Responsibilities:

- Financial Reporting and Compliance:
- Prepare and present monthly, quarterly, and annual financial reports in compliance with relevant financial standards (e.g., IFRS, GAAP).
- Ensure timely submission of financial statements, tax returns, and other regulatory filings.
- Conduct internal audits and oversee external audit processes.
- Manage VAT, GST, and other indirect taxes relevant to the pharmaceutical or trading industry.
- Stay updated with the latest tax laws, accounting regulations, and industry-specific financial standards.
- Financial Planning and Analysis:
- Provide accurate financial forecasting and budgeting support.
- Perform variance analysis to identify and explain deviations from the budget.
- Assist in strategic decision-making by preparing detailed financial analysis reports.
- Evaluate and manage cost-control measures to improve profitability, focusing on areas such as inventory management, distribution costs, and R&D; expenses (in case of the pharmaceutical industry).
- Costing and Inventory Management (Pharmaceutical / Trading):
- Develop and monitor effective costing methods for pharmaceutical products or trading activities.




- Ensure accurate valuation of inventories, including raw materials, work-in-progress, and finished goods.
- Analyze inventory turnover rates and support effective stock management strategies.
- Oversee transfer pricing and ensure compliance with international pricing guidelines (especially for trading).
- Cash Flow and Treasury Management:
- Oversee cash flow management and ensure sufficient liquidity for day-to-day operations.
- Manage short-term and long-term financial forecasting to ensure business continuity.
- Monitor the working capital cycle, including receivables, payables, and inventory.
- Regulatory Compliance and Risk Management:
- Ensure compliance with national and international regulations related to accounting and finance.
- Assess and manage financial risks, including currency fluctuations, interest rates, and industry-specific regulatory risks.
- Develop and implement strategies to mitigate financial risks, such as pricing pressures in the pharmaceutical market or volatility in commodity trading.
- Internal Controls & Process Improvement:
- Develop and maintain internal control systems to safeguard company assets and ensure accuracy in financial reporting.
- Suggest process improvements to optimize financial operations and improve business efficiencies.
- Team Leadership & Collaboration:
- Lead and mentor the finance team,



providing guidance on technical accounting matters and professional development.
- Collaborate with other departments such as sales, procurement, and operations to ensure financial goals align with the overall business strategy.
- Assist in the preparation of financial reports for senior management and board presentations.

Qualifications & Experience:

- Chartered Accountant (CA) qualification.
- Minimum of [5] years of experience in the pharmaceutical or trading industry.
- In-depth knowledge of financial accounting standards (IFRS, GAAP) and industry-specific regulations.
- Robust understanding of costing methodologies, inventory management, and taxation in the pharmaceutical/trading industry.
- Proven experience in managing audits, financial statements, budgeting, and forecasting.
- Familiarity with financial software and ERP systems (e.g., SAP, Oracle, Tally, etc.).
- Proficient in Excel and other financial tools for analysis and reporting.

Key Skills:

- Strong analytical, financial modeling, and reporting skills.
- Excellent understanding of financial management and cost accounting in pharmaceutical/trading sectors.
- Attention to detail with the ability to multitask and meet deadlines.
- Strong leadership and interpersonal skills.
- Good knowledge of local and international tax laws applicable to the pharmaceutical or trading industry.
- Strong communication and presentation skills for reporting to senior management.

Desirable:

- Experience in a global or multi-national pharmaceutical or trading company.
- Exposure to regulatory bodies and compliance frameworks in the pharmaceutical or trading sectors.
- Knowledge of transfer pricing and international tax planning.
